  1. What is the primary significance of teaching Environmental Studies (EVS)?
    [A] To develop scientific skills
    [B] To integrate science with social sciences
    [C] To promote environmental awareness
    [D] To teach practical skills
    Answer: [C] To promote environmental awareness
  2. Integration of science and social science in EVS curriculum primarily aims to:
    [A] Reduce curriculum load
    [B] Create interdisciplinary learning
    [C] Focus on practical learning
    [D] Improve examination results
    Answer: [B] Create interdisciplinary learning
  3. Which of the following is NOT an objective of teaching and learning EVS?
    [A] To develop critical thinking
    [B] To promote social skills
    [C] To impart technical knowledge
    [D] To encourage sustainable practices
    Answer: [C] To impart technical knowledge
  4. Which method in teaching EVS involves students conducting experiments and activities?
    [A] Survey
    [B] Practical Work
    [C] Discussion
    [D] Observation
    Answer: [B] Practical Work
  5. The approach in EVS where learning is centered around a particular theme or topic is called:
    [A] Survey-based approach
    [B] Activity-based approach
    [C] Project-based approach
    [D] Theme-based approach
    Answer: [D] Theme-based approach
